EVP, Chief Information Technology Officer (Regina)
SGI
Key Accountabilities Strategic Executive Leadership Collaboratively, as part of the ELT, develops short‑ and long‑term strategic direction of the corporation. Establishes short‑ and long‑term goals to achieve strategies and integrate into the division and the organization and ensures programs and policies align with corporate, strategic and divisional strategies, Board of Directors, CIC and/or government policy.
Works collaboratively and acts as ELT sponsor on cross‑divisional priorities, collaboratively makes decisions on current and future initiatives with a corporate lens while ensuring an SGI First approach.
Demonstrates a deep understanding of Crown governance structure, principles and regulatory requirements and stays informed of shareholder goals and expectations to ensure consideration and alignment in the development and implementation of SGI strategy, programs and policies.
Works collaboratively to establish robust direction on budget, FTE and expense management to ensure long‑term success of the corporation. Manages the commitments and resourcing requirements to deliver on the organization’s goals and strategies. Responsible for organizational succession readiness and actively manages and ensures progressive movement in employees growth and development and forward thinking.
Partners with executive and senior leadership in the development of customer strategies and champions a customer‑centric philosophy and effort throughout the organization.
Leads, directs and monitors change management strategies/plans to support and align to divisional and corporate strategies and to gain acceptance of divisional strategies by other business areas and partners. Manages risk in area of authority and participates on the Risk Management Steering Committee to support the establishment and mitigation of enterprise risk management framework.
Approves and oversees divisional budget and collaborates on the corporate budget and financial strategies. In collaboration with the CEO, submits, represents and tables financial and other strategic reports and requests to government and Cabinet. Demonstrates commitment by embedding the value of safety in every level of the corporation and encourage the recognition that safety is everyone’s responsibility.
Leads and/or prepares, reviews and approves decision and information items for ELT, Board of Directors, Ministers Office and Cabinet. Establishes and maintains an effective system of internal controls to support reliable financial reporting and compliance in accordance with applicable laws and regulations within the span of control, and communicates the importance of internal controls to staff. Corporate Technology and Data Office Enablement Leads ongoing enhancements, evolution and roadmap of the technology estate, cyber security program and data office for the organization and ensures its integration with the corporate strategic planning process and resulting business strategy and plans.
Provides single point of coordination and executive oversight for all technology estate and data office initiatives. Articulates the vision and latest industry developments in technology ecosystem capabilities with Executive and Senior Management to enable realization of digital insurer aspirations.
Ensures that the organization exploits technology investments and establishes technology partnerships to create a competitive edge for SGI.
Leads the development and long‑term maturation of enterprise data office capabilities, ensuring the vision, roadmap and governance for data management, data architecture, quality, integration, and stewardship align with strategic goals. Oversees the continuous evolution toward integrated, enterprise‑wide data models and scalable analytics capabilities, enabling increasingly sophisticated data‑driven decision making and adapting to changing strategic priorities.
Oversees transformation programs and continual improvement of processes to deliver sustainable and responsive service to partners, customers, and employees. Understands end users needs and preferences and ensures these are translated into intuitive, efficient technology solutions, working in collaboration with business and marketing partners to ensure alignment with the business strategy and corporate experience strategies.
Establishes a framework to monitor, analyze and regularly report performance metrics of the technology estate, ensuring realization of balanced scorecard metrics. Develops strategic industry and technology partnerships enabling SGI to achieve corporate objectives. Understands and anticipates competitors technological developments and recommends strategic opportunities. Information Technology Strategy Leads a team of experts to create and evolve end‑to‑end approaches to IT aligned with Corporate and Business Strategy objectives and goals.
Ensures SGI technology estate evolution is architected to enable business priorities and outcome delivery. Ensures core IT systems and structure align to achieve corporate goals and objectives.
Identifies opportunities/risks for the appropriate and cost‑effective investment of financial resources in IT systems/resources and approves, prioritizes, and recommends projects as they relate to the selection, acquisition, development, and installation of major IT systems.
Oversees the IT budget and provides a clear rationale for investments and impact on business outcome metrics. Stays current with industry dynamics, how partners and competitors use technology, industry trends and issues, as well as current and emerging technologies in order to support the delivery of technology solutions that improve business outcomes. Information Technology Development, Acquisition, Deployment & Support Provides leadership of the information technology and data office division by overseeing portfolio delivery, day‑to‑day operations of technology applications and infrastructure, and delivery of reliable IT service support to enable business operations.
Ensures continuous improvement of business technology services. Provides strategic oversight of IT security, cybersecurity frameworks, data protection, and incident response, in compliance with the Business Continuity Program framework as well as applicable regulations and industry standards.
Oversees third‑party technology service delivery, including contract negotiation and vendor management. Oversees management of the lifecycle of IT assets according to established standards and policies and ensure tech debt targets are achieved.
Oversees and ensures alignment of human resource capacity and skillset requirements for current and emerging technology estate components. Change Management Ensures the development and execution of change management strategies to support and align to the corporate, business and IT strategies, and recommends changes to processes, procedures and systems as required to enable business outcome delivery.
Leads, directs, and influences evolution to a continuous improvement operating model in IT and across SGI where appropriate.
Establishes and drives customer‑centricity in decision‑making and delivery in IT. People Leadership Builds a high‑performing workforce by actively leading human resource activities. Ensures development of corporate and divisional succession plans. Builds a culture of leadership and accountability to effectively deliver on strategic and corporate strategies, ensuring integration with employee performance development and career development plans.
Drives performance through team members and is committed to leadership development across the company, supporting employees and workforce readiness through mentoring, training, and developmental opportunities. Education and Experience Master’s degree from an accredited post‑secondary educational institution in a relevant field of study, such as Business.
Twenty years of relevant experience in the insurance field or in a large digital space within business, including at least thirteen years of progressively challenging leadership experience.
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ities Knowledge of strategy development, digital technologies, methodologies pertaining to research, customer experience, business process improvement, governance, and change management.
Knowledge of trends, developments, improvements and innovation in IT, IT industry best practices and IT architectures and infrastructure.
Knowledge of the insurance industry and skill to continually evolve strategic business development and distribution strategies and tactics.
Knowledge of corporate inter‑relationships and how they interact to achieve corporate objectives.
Knowledge of how accounting/financial information contributes to management understanding and decisions.
Knowledge of project management methodologies and techniques required to plan, manage and execute projects.
Ability to have effective internal working relationships and ability to establish strategic external partnerships with customers, business partners, vendors, and others.
Skills in understanding how corporate products, services and solutions meet or fail in meeting customer’s needs.
Leadership skills to lead and execute corporate change through influence, persuasion, and consensus building.
Leadership skills to foster an environment which motivates and encourages employees to develop and perform to achieve organizational objectives.
Communication skills to provide technical advice or guidance to internal/external customers where expertise is required to negotiate with, influence and/or convince.
Skill in writing high‑quality reports that are clear, concise, and targeted to the audience.
Skill to define and manage project and operating budgets.
Skill in managing and monitoring multiple projects within constrained timelines. #J-18808-Ljbffr
